Bulgaria’s heavy transport association has joined ESTA as its expansion in Eastern Europe continues. NSPIT - the Bulgarian Association for the Transportation of Oversized Cargoes – was formed three years ago as part of the industry’s attempts to update the country’s regulations governing heavy transport. NSPIT hopes that joining will increase ESTA’s influence in the Balkans and also make ESTA itself stronger.
